是中国剩余定理(Chinese Remainder Theorem,CRT)。中国剩余定理是一种数论定理,用于求解一组同余方程的问题,其中每个方程都有不同的模数。
中国剩余定理的步骤如下:
- 首先,将给定的大数模方程转化为一组同余方程。例如,对于大数模方程 x ≡ a1 (mod m1), x ≡ a2 (mod m2), ..., x ≡ an (mod mn),将其转化为同余方程组 x ≡ r1 (mod n1), x ≡ r2 (mod n2), ..., x ≡ rn (mod nn),其中 ni = m1 * m2 * ... * mi-1 * mi+1 * ... * mn,ri 是满足同余关系的一个整数。
- 使用扩展欧几里得算法求解同余方程组中的系数。通过计算每个 ni 的乘法逆元 si,可得到同余方程组的系数 x ≡ r1 * s1 * n1 + r2 * s2 * n2 + ... + rn * sn * nn (mod n1 * n2 * ... * nn)。
- 计算同余方程组的最小非负整数解。由于同余方程组的解 x 可以通过 x ≡ x0 (mod n1 * n2 * ... * nn) 表示,其中 x0 是任意整数解,因此可以通过取模运算计算最小非负整数解。
中国剩余定理在密码学、编码与解码、数据压缩等领域有广泛的应用。
推荐腾讯云相关产品:
腾讯云提供了各种云计算相关的产品,以下是一些与中国剩余定理相关的腾讯云产品和链接:
- 腾讯云数学工具包:提供了多个数学计算工具,包括求解同余方程的方法。链接:https://cloud.tencent.com/product/mathematical-toolkit
- 腾讯云计算服务:提供了强大的计算能力,可以用于执行中国剩余定理算法和其他复杂计算任务。链接:https://cloud.tencent.com/product/cvm
请注意,以上推荐的腾讯云产品仅供参考,实际选择应根据具体需求和情况进行。